AXForum  
Вернуться   AXForum > Microsoft Dynamics AX > DAX: Администрирование
All
Забыли пароль?
Зарегистрироваться Правила Справка Пользователи Сообщения за день Поиск Все разделы прочитаны

 
 
Опции темы Поиск в этой теме Опции просмотра
Старый 26.04.2006, 11:36   #1  
sergeypp is offline
sergeypp
Ищу людей. Дорого.
Аватар для sergeypp
 
433 / 174 (6) ++++++
Регистрация: 08.11.2003
Адрес: Казань
Странное поведение сессий
Мониторил сессии, немного настораживает одно обстоятельство
Сессия открывает транзакцию и замирет, статус у нее AWAITING COMMAND
и все. никаких команд она не выполняет - просто висит, причем висеть может довольно долго. А тем временем она успешно блокирует другие сесси, поскольку ресурс уже захватила
Может кто-нибудь объяснить или посоветовать как определить что же она такое делает?
Старый 26.04.2006, 12:16   #2  
Sada is offline
Sada
Программатор
Аватар для Sada
 
1,450 / 153 (8) ++++++
Регистрация: 29.03.2005
Адрес: Толи Барнаул, толи Москва
Какую таблицу захватывает?
Что пользователь запустил, что возникла такая ситуация?
Старый 26.04.2006, 12:55   #3  
sergeypp is offline
sergeypp
Ищу людей. Дорого.
Аватар для sergeypp
 
433 / 174 (6) ++++++
Регистрация: 08.11.2003
Адрес: Казань
Сейчас нет такой ситуации, как появится, обязательно отпишусь
Старый 26.04.2006, 14:59   #4  
sergeypp is offline
sergeypp
Ищу людей. Дорого.
Аватар для sergeypp
 
433 / 174 (6) ++++++
Регистрация: 08.11.2003
Адрес: Казань
нашел пример
63 171 geac-user domoNew sleeping EXECUTE LCK_M_U KEY: 10:405888813:3 (3602abc3fa2a)
64 0 aos2-client domoNew sleeping AWAITING COMMAND not waiting
83 156 aos2-client domoNew sleeping EXECUTE LCK_M_U KEY: 10:157347725:1 (b202a1079a4f)
130 156 olap-terminal domoNew sleeping EXECUTE LCK_M_U KEY: 10:157347725:1 (b002ec2605cf)
154 225 geac-user domoNew sleeping EXECUTE LCK_M_U KEY: 10:58951782:1 (04025c9af58d)
156 64 aos-client domoNew sleeping EXECUTE LCK_M_S KEY: 10:638677373:1 (d00246ae52dd)
171 156 geac-user domoNew sleeping EXECUTE LCK_M_U KEY: 10:157347725:1 (b502f1622438)
182 171 aos2-client domoNew sleeping EXECUTE LCK_M_S KEY: 10:573661537:1 (0002790f8c7b)
225 83 aos2-client domoNew sleeping EXECUTE LCK_M_U KEY: 10:157347725:1 (b202a1079a4f)
249 182 olap-terminal domoNew sleeping EXECUTE LCK_M_U KEY: 10:1844969699:1 (0403d8578477)


Процесс 64 висит
он блокирует процесс 156. Смотрим какой ресурс он ожидает.
64 domoNew.dbo.INVENTSUM I_174ITEMDIMIDX KEY X GRANT Xact (d00246ae52dd)
вот такая бяда и висит ужо полчаса (
Старый 26.04.2006, 17:14   #5  
Recoilme is offline
Recoilme
злыдень
Аватар для Recoilme
Злыдни
 
895 / 192 (8) ++++++
Регистрация: 18.06.2003
1. у Вас ОЛАП по живой базе шуршит, где люди копошатся??
2. Сделать INVENTSUM I_174ITEMDIMIDX KEY кластерным не пробовали?
3. Отмониторить запрос, кот вгоняет в ступор и прогнать его через QA?
__________________
Ибо зло есть лучшая сила человека. "Человек должен становиться все лучше и злее" -- так учу я. /Ф. Ницше/
Старый 27.04.2006, 09:30   #6  
sergeypp is offline
sergeypp
Ищу людей. Дорого.
Аватар для sergeypp
 
433 / 174 (6) ++++++
Регистрация: 08.11.2003
Адрес: Казань
Он кластерный.
запросы смотрел везде вроде index seek скана по индексу или по таблице не видел
Старый 27.04.2006, 09:50   #7  
Recoilme is offline
Recoilme
злыдень
Аватар для Recoilme
Злыдни
 
895 / 192 (8) ++++++
Регистрация: 18.06.2003
Попробуйте посмотреть что скажут sp_lock
http://msdn.microsoft.com/library/de...la-lz_6cdn.asp
И sp_who2
Лучше всеж найти причину в первоисточнике (акзапте)
ЗЫ: tempdb не опухла?
__________________
Ибо зло есть лучшая сила человека. "Человек должен становиться все лучше и злее" -- так учу я. /Ф. Ницше/
Старый 27.04.2006, 10:00   #8  
sergeypp is offline
sergeypp
Ищу людей. Дорого.
Аватар для sergeypp
 
433 / 174 (6) ++++++
Регистрация: 08.11.2003
Адрес: Казань
я своими процедурами пользуюсь sp_lock и sp_who меня не удовлетворяют
по поводу tempdb - он лежит на системном, отдельно от базы в нем 4 файла одинакого размера (по кол-ву процов) по 3 гб в каждом
Старый 27.04.2006, 10:25   #9  
Recoilme is offline
Recoilme
злыдень
Аватар для Recoilme
Злыдни
 
895 / 192 (8) ++++++
Регистрация: 18.06.2003
круто, а что процедурки показывают?
sp_who2 чуть подробней sp_who
Мы обычно мониторим кто запустил долгоиграющий процесс, что он делает и пытаемся оптимизировать код. Например кто то активно работает с остатками длит-ое время, напр. инвент-ия создается.
__________________
Ибо зло есть лучшая сила человека. "Человек должен становиться все лучше и злее" -- так учу я. /Ф. Ницше/
Старый 27.04.2006, 10:40   #10  
sergeypp is offline
sergeypp
Ищу людей. Дорого.
Аватар для sergeypp
 
433 / 174 (6) ++++++
Регистрация: 08.11.2003
Адрес: Казань
А как определяете что он именно инвентаризацию делает а не учитывает что либо?
Старый 27.04.2006, 11:03   #11  
Recoilme is offline
Recoilme
злыдень
Аватар для Recoilme
Злыдни
 
895 / 192 (8) ++++++
Регистрация: 18.06.2003
спрашиваем. Точней он сам прибежит, я тут закупку делаю из 4000 строк, а эта дура аксапта уже час висит.
__________________
Ибо зло есть лучшая сила человека. "Человек должен становиться все лучше и злее" -- так учу я. /Ф. Ницше/
Старый 27.04.2006, 11:09   #12  
sergeypp is offline
sergeypp
Ищу людей. Дорого.
Аватар для sergeypp
 
433 / 174 (6) ++++++
Регистрация: 08.11.2003
Адрес: Казань
ааа ) понятно
скрипты я получил путем трассировки профайлером действий по просмотру блокировок из EM. нашел нужные процедуры, разобрал их и подкорректировал
особенно удобно смотреть первоисточники блокировок и то какие ресурсы они блокируют
тем более я могу мониторить по отдельному пользователю или по базе смотреть какие ресурсы держит определенный юзер
стандартными процедурами так не получится
 

Похожие темы
Тема Автор Раздел Ответов Посл. сообщение
Странное поведение складских проводок в закупках skof DAX: Прочие вопросы 7 11.10.2005 14:56
Странное поведение при использовании карантина VIS DAX: Функционал 22 15.09.2005 18:40
Странное поведение резервирования после создания спланированной закупки. NEO DAX: Функционал 7 01.07.2004 14:03
Странное поведение Join Ser DAX: Программирование 14 27.05.2004 17:32
Странное поведение третьей Аксапты Irvine DAX: Администрирование 4 19.05.2003 19:29
Опции темы Поиск в этой теме
Поиск в этой теме:

Расширенный поиск
Опции просмотра
Комбинированный вид Комбинированный вид

Ваши права в разделе
Вы не можете создавать новые темы
Вы не можете отвечать в темах
Вы не можете прикреплять вложения
Вы не можете редактировать свои сообщения

BB коды Вкл.
Смайлы Вкл.
[IMG] код Вкл.
HTML код Выкл.
Быстрый переход

Рейтинг@Mail.ru
Часовой пояс GMT +3, время: 18:44.